Recent advancements in generative artificial intelligence (generative AI), such as diffusion models, generative adversarial networks (GANs), and large language models (LLMs), have opened new frontiers in medical imaging, diagnostics, treatment planning, and patient communication. These technologies enable the synthesis of realistic medical images, the generation of clinical reports, and the simulation of rare disease scenarios, providing novel solutions to longstanding problems in healthcare.
